2020-02-06 21:50:28 +00:00
2020-02-06 21:50:28 +00:00
2020-02-06 21:29:45 +00:00
2020-02-06 21:29:45 +00:00
2020-02-06 21:29:45 +00:00
2020-02-06 21:29:45 +00:00
2020-02-06 21:29:45 +00:00
2020-02-06 21:29:45 +00:00
2020-02-06 21:39:22 +00:00
2020-02-06 21:29:45 +00:00

Sliide-news-reader

Login to Sliide news reader and see content based on user role

Requirements

  • Minimum android SDK version 26
  • Permissions : Internet

Features

  • Login Screen
  • User roles (Premium & Basic)
  • Slide images through multiple images on content (if available)
  • Open links to the new article by clicking the title

Architectural Pattern

MVVM - Model View Viewmodel

Jetpack

Unit tests

Test case one

  • Testing of room database queries

Test case two

  • UI test for authentification testing during login procedure

Built With

  • Kodein - Painless Kotlin Dependency Injection
  • Retrofit - Type-safe HTTP client for Android and Java by Square, Inc
  • Room Persistence Library - The library helps you create a cache of your app's data on a device that's running your app
  • Picasso - A powerful image downloading and caching library for Android

Authors

  • Haider Malik - Android Developer
Description
No description provided
Readme 169 KiB
Languages
Kotlin 100%